From the other side of the consultation, briefly.

Dose-response modeling for tirzepatide: Emax model fitting to the STEP/SURMOUNT dose-finding data shows:

Semaglutide: ED50 ≈ 0.6mg, Emax ≈ -18%, Hill coefficient ≈ 1.3
Tirzepatide: ED50 ≈ 6mg, Emax ≈ -25%, Hill coefficient ≈ 1.5

Clinical implication: most patients achieve >80% of maximal response by the mid-range dose (1.7mg sema, 10mg tirz). Going to the maximum dose provides diminishing returns — possibly not worth the additional side effect burden for some patients. Individualize dosing based on response vs tolerability.

I read this differently from Dr.GutHealth, on substance rather than tone. The trial means are being read too generously in this thread. STEP populations were selected, supported, and titrated by protocol, and the real-world curves are consistently a few points worse. That difference is not noise, it is what happens when you remove the study infrastructure.
